Alkaliphiles are organisms, typically bacteria, that thrive in environments with high alkalinity, having a pH of 8 or above. These microorganisms have adapted to survive and grow in conditions that would be detrimental to most other life forms.

An alkaliphile is an organism, typically a microorganism such as a bacterium, that thrives in alkaline environments with a pH of 8 or higher. These organisms have adapted to live and grow in high-pH conditions and can be found in various ecological niches, including alkaline lakes, hot springs, and soil.
